Transaction 684b1328aa5ac383bc4d946e04123494ccd422084e30c05e8585bd1a394a5fdb
1 Input
1 Output
-
684b1328aa5ac383bc4d946e04123494ccd422084e30c05e8585bd1a394a5fdb:0
- value
- 128598965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 104a23271f7b28c93653a33c0abbd7a03ad7f387 OP_EQUAL
- address
- 33B9YmGVWGWp3CScVM67cN558vmo8L9Ugc